Description
Job Description: Nuclear Medicine Technologist
Position Summary:
A Nuclear Medicine Technologist (NMT) prepares and administers radiopharmaceuticals, operates imaging equipment, and works closely with physicians to diagnose and treat diseases. This role combines technical expertise with patient care and safety practices.
Key Responsibilities:
Patient Preparation:
Interview and screen patients prior to procedures
Explain test procedures and ensure informed consent
Position patients correctly for scans
Radiopharmaceutical Handling:
Prepare and administer radioactive drugs
Monitor patients for adverse reactions
Adhere to safety protocols for storage and disposal
Imaging and Equipment Operation:
Operate gamma cameras, PET/CT scanners, and related equipment
Capture diagnostic images as ordered by a physician
Calibrate and maintain imaging equipment
Data Management:
Process and analyze scan data
Prepare detailed diagnostic reports for physician interpretation
Maintain accurate patient and procedure records
Safety and Compliance:
Follow radiation safety procedures and monitor exposure levels
Comply with state, federal, and institutional regulations
Participate in quality assurance and control programs
Collaboration:
Work with physicians, radiologists, and other healthcare providers
Assist in scheduling and coordinating imaging procedures
Train and supervise student technologists or new staff
Qualifications:
Associate’s or Bachelor’s degree in Nuclear Medicine Technology or related field
Certification by:
ARRT (Nuclear Medicine – NM) or
NMTCB (Nuclear Medicine Technology Certification Board)
Strong understanding of anatomy, physiology, and radiopharmaceuticals
Excellent communication and interpersonal skills
Licensure and Certification Requirements by State:
Licensing requirements for NMTs vary by state. Here's a general breakdown:
States that Require Licensure or Certification:
These states require NMTs to be licensed or certified to practice (most accept ARRT or NMTCB certification as a requirement for licensure):
California
Florida
Illinois
Massachusetts
New York
Ohio
Texas
Washington
New Jersey
Tennessee
Maryland
Nevada
Oregon
West Virginia
South Carolina
Alabama
Kentucky
Connecticut
Rhode Island
States with No Formal State Licensure (but certification typically required by employers):
These states do not have a state license requirement, but most employers still require ARRT or NMTCB certification:
Arizona
Colorado
Georgia
Idaho
Montana
New Hampshire
South Dakota
Vermont
Wisconsin
Wyoming
Note: Always check with the state’s Radiologic Health Board or Department of Health for the most current regulations.
